Allowlists and Blocklists are two types of list-based security mechanisms used to control access and filter content. An Allowlist, also known as a White List, is a list of authorized items or sources that are explicitly permitted to access or interact with a system or network. Conversely, a Blocklist, also known as a Black List, is a list of prohibited items or sources that are explicitly denied access or interaction with a system or network.
